The U.S. is planning to provide Ukraine with an aid package of $700-800 million for the domestic production of long-range capabilities, President Volodymyr Zelensky told journalists on Oct. 21.

On the same day, U.S. Defense Secretary Lloyd Austin announced a new $400 million military aid package during a surprise visit to Kyiv. In addition, it was also announced that Washington is preparing to provide $800 million for the production of Ukrainian drones.

Zelensky and Austin also discussed how much of the $8 billion in aid the U.S. announced in late September could be dedicated to Ukrainian production by the end of the year.
